4.4.6CONNECTING MULTIPLE PROCESSORS TO AN ETHERNET NETWORK

Use the front panel Ethernet port and a standard Ethernet cable to connect each processor to a 10, 10/100, or 100 Mbps Ethernet hub, switch, or router on a network.

4.4.7CONNECTING MULTIPLE PROCESSORS TO AN ETHERNET AND U-NET NETWORK

Use the front panel Ethernet port and a standard Ethernet cable to connect processors to a 10, 10/100, or 100 Mbps Ethernet hub, switch, or router on the network. Connect additional processors to the Ethernet hub, switch, or router or connect additional processors to the system using the U-Net ports as in Section 4.4.4.

NOTE: Audio signals may also be routed between processors over the same U-Net cables by assigning Input Channel and Output Channel signals to U-Net channels.

4.4.8 SOFTWARE INSTALLATION -- EAWPILOT EAWPilot requires an IBM compatible PC equipped as follows:

Operating System:

Windows Vista, XP, 2000, NT, ME, or Windows 98

I/O:

Ethernet network interface card (NIC) 10, 10/100, or 100 Mbps

The latest EAWPilot can be downloaded from the EAW web site: www.eaw.com. Go to the “Downloads” page or contact the factory and a copy will be sent to you on a CD-ROM. Once installed and with the computer connected to the UX8800, open EAWPilot by clicking on EAWPilot in the Start/Programs/EAW/EAWPilot.
